Khelif, born female in Algeria, faces a false backlash for allegedly being transgender. Recently, successful female athletes are accused of being trans, prompting "sex tests" in many sports
Taiwanese boxer Lin Yu-Ting also faces these allegations at the Olympics, despite a decade in the sport. Why?
Last year, Khelif and Yu-Ting competed in the World Championships by the International Boxing Association (IBA), led by a Russian national and funded by Russian Gazprom.
IBA still allow Russian boxers to participate in the events under Russian flag.
Lin's medal was revoked for failing a "sex test," and Khelif faced similar accusations after beating a Russian opponent.
See not before, they were banned after winning.
The IBA, banned from the Olympics for corruption and bias, now claims the Olympic Committee allows "men pretending to be women" to participate in women's sports.
But they failed the test right? Russian led IBA doesn't disclose what their "sex test" is, making these accusations questionable.
Also the IBA's Russian head Umar Kremlev alleged Khelif and Lin have male chromosomes without any proof.
His allegations spread through Russian state media and later to international ones. But what for?
Russia is doing this to sow discord in Western societies and even between Western governments.
